So, in the interest of saving everyone (us) time (and money) here are the seven key trends, according to a study done by Pinterest, to buy into this spring.
Â
Backless Shoes
It doesn’t matter if it’s a mule, loafer, or the Vetements x Manolo kitten heels (which we’re partial to), get yourself a pedicure where they do that heel scrapey thing, then get yourself some backless shoes.
Â
Ruffles
Ruffles have been *a thing* for a while now, and we still love them. The more dramatic, the better!
Â
Paperbag Waist
Ugh, is there anything cooler than a pair of paperbag waist trousers? Answer: no.
Â
Sheer...Everything
There were *a lot* of nipples on the spring 2017 runways! For the more shy among us, wear your sheer top or dress with vintage-inspired underthings.
Â
Khaki
Khaki’s (and cargo pants!) are back, and we never thought we’d say this, but we’re excited about it!
Â
Trenches
We totally called this one. This season’s trenches aren’t just olive or khaki—look for one in a fun color or finish like patent leather—another big trend!
Â
Corset Belts
Corset belts make a huge difference in your outfit, with minimal effort. Wear them over anything—from a simple t-shirt to a patterned dress—to completely transform your look.
Â
Florals
Florals for spring...groundbreaking. But this season’s florals are bigger and weirder than ever before, and we’re totally into it.
